  • Brief Description: 
    The Rotary Club of Johnson City has a very active Facebook page https://www.facebook.com/rotaryclubofjohnsoncity/ and Twitter @RotaryJCTN.
    Our Facebook page has had 235 posts between Feb 1, 2015 and Jan 20, 2016; this averages to 5 posts per week. Posts consist of upcoming events of our club, area club events, district news and events, and Rotary International news, new members, Paul Harris Fellow presentations, social and service projects, Rotary Foundation posts, motivational posts, and news of interest to Rotarians. We have uploaded over 300 pictures of our own Rotarians at meetings, participating in service projects, or enjoying socials.
    We currently have 375 followers on our page from the TriCities area, District 7570, and have reached 39 different countries. We have had 1309 post "likes"; 56 post comments; and 69 post shares. We have a reach (the number of people who received impressions of a Page post) of over 26,000 on our posts with impressions (he number of times a post from your Page is displayed) totaling over 44,000. This year each quarter we are averaging 700 engaged users on our Facebook page.
    Our twitter page has 72 followers and we have 231 tweets that include activities our club is doing as well as retweeting Rotarian's business or event tweets.

  • Resulting Benefits: 
    The first benefit is keeping our club informed on what is happening in our club, district, and internationally in the Rotary world. They can miss a meeting an still feel like they were there.
    The second benefit is we are reaching much further than just club members and Johnson City. Having reached 39 countries throughout the world is surprising and wonderful news to our club, because we are promoting Rotary literally throughout the world from our small town!
    The third benefit is supporting organizations we partner with or have programs from weekly. This helps to expand their reach to people who may not know the good their organizations does and conversely they might be part of that organization and not be familiar with Rotary.
    The last is it is fun. Rotarians and their friends love seeing pictures of themselves and others in action and doing good or having fun. We want the public image of Rotary to be a fun, vibrant organization that does so much good in the community and the world.
